Spirit of Egypt

Egypt, 6 Nights

See the classical sights of Egypt in a nutshell with three nights in Cairo and 3 nights aboard A&K's Nile Adventurer cruise boat. 

Day 1 - London/Cairo.

Fly from London Heathrow with bmi arriving to bustling Cairo in the late afternoon. Transfer to the centrally located Semiramis InterContinental in time for dinner in one of the wide variety of restaurants on offer.

Day 2 - Cairo.
After a leisurely morning explore the fascinating Egyptian Antiquities Museum where you will discover many unbelievable archaeological treasures, including the riches of Tutankhamun. Silently view the Mummies Room, a specially-built area dedicated to the well-preserved mummies of 11 Royal Kings and Queens of Ancient Egypt, including the Great Ramses II, Egypt's longest ruling pharaoh.

Day 3 - Cairo.

Spend the morning at the magnificent Pyramids at Giza and huge Sphinx with time to behold the unique Solar Boat Museum. The afternoon is at leisure or you may choose from the many sights of Cairo, ask your consultant for details.

Day 4 - Cairo/Aswan.
Early this morning fly to Aswan to join your floating home Nile Adventurer. Meet your Egyptologist guide who will escort you around the classical sights of Aswan. Enjoy a short motorboat ride to visit the romantic and majestic Philae Temple on the Island of Agilka. See the Granite Quarries, which supplied the ancient Egyptians with most of the hard stone used in pyramids and temples, and still holds a huge unfinished obelisk. A relaxing afternoon tea awaits your return to boat. Served in the lounge enjoy a range of teas and herbal infusions, fresh coffee and a selection of freshly baked homemade cake and cookies. Late this evening learn more about Egyptian life with our Boat Manager whilst sipping Egyptian wine or local beer, served together with a selection of canapés before dinner.

Day 5 - Aswan/Esna.
Cruise leisurely to Kom Ombo to see the temple dedicated to the crocodile-god Sobek. The temple stands at a bend in the Nile where in ancient times sacred crocodiles basked in the sun on the riverbank. Cruise onto Edfu with time to enjoy a leisurely lunch. Explore the largest and most completely preserved Pharaonic - albeit Greek-built - temple in Egypt, the extraordinary Temple of Horus at Edfu.  Dress up in traditional Egyptian "galabeyas" for a lavish buffet of Egyptian specialities, followed by Oriental music and dancing.

Day 6 - Esna/Luxor.
Be amazed in the Valley of the Kings and Queens, a vast City of the Dead where magnificent tombs were carved into the desert rocks, decorated richly, and filled with treasures for the afterlife by generations of Pharaohs. Rising out of the desert plain in a series of terraces walk to the Temple of Queen Hatshepsut which merges with the sheer limestone cliffs that surround it. Explore the fabled temples of Luxor and Karnak and see the great "Hypostyle Hall"  an incredible forest of giant pillars.

Day 7 - Luxor/Cairo/London.

Fly to Cairo to connect with your international flight to London, or alternatively extend for a leisurely stay on the Red Sea at the sophisticated Oberoi Sahl Hasheesh.
